Importance of Sivarathri Virutham
All of us know about Sivarathri,famous for Lord Siva.In Hindu religion this is observed as a fast day and one used to wake up all throughout night on that day.Many episodes are there.Here is a story that I read recently which I would like to share.
There was a learned Pandit in a village.He had a son named Vedanidhi who was of a bad virtue and habit. The Pandit tried his level best to correct him. All in vain.
One day Vedanidhi stole a golden ring of his father whom the king had presented him for his loyal duty.He gave that to a dancing girl in the king"s court as his present.The king happened to see the ring and got wild on the pandit.
This made the pandit more annoyed and chased him out of the house.His friends did not entertain him any more.So he walked a long distance and because of fatigue fainted.When he woke up he saw some people singing the Praise of Siva and going to a near by temple of Lord Siva.He came to know that was a Sivarathri day.He joined them.
In the temple he saw many fruits coins near the shrine.He wanted to get some so he entered the inner shrine.The light was not sufficent for him to steal.So he tore his dhothi made wick and made the lamp still brighter than before and stole.But poor boy he was caught and beaten.He lost his life.
When Yama came he took him to deva loka,though he had committed so many sins.But Yama said though Vedanidhi did sins he also did a virtuous act by lighting the lamp of the Lord and starved the whole day and died on sivarathri day.All these good acts made him to attain heaven.
So if an bad virtued boy attained heaven without knowing the real importance of Sivarathri Lord siva will surely bless his devotees who take up this virtutham on Sivarathri day.
